We invited some of the family over for dinner and got to work making the Manwich. Which actually doesn’t really take any work at all. I had really forgotten how quick it is to make Sloppy Joes.

All you have to do it brown the hamburger, drain the grease and then add in the Manwich. Make sure that everything is hot and then it’s ready to serve. It might have taken up a whole 15 minutes to make all three cans of Manwich. Now that’s a quick dinner!
